On Resonant Mythologies, composer Konstantinos Karathanasis creates an imaginative sound world where memory, symbolism, and sonic exploration intersect. The album presents vivid musical narratives across works for fixed media, electronics, and solo instruments, ranging from the playful transformation of everyday life in Ode to Kitchen to the intimate dialogue of Piece for Flute and Electronics. Themes of ritual, landscape, and feminist reinterpretations of myth shape compositions such as Hekate, Trittico Mediterraneo, and Medusa in Somno. The result is a cohesive and evocative body of work, distinguished by refined sonic detail and strong narrative expression.
Konstantinos Karathanasis, born in Athens in 1975, is a composer whose early exposure to piano and improvisation shaped his artistic path. He studied at the National Conservatory in Athens and the Ionian University, where he pioneered live electronics composition in Greek academia. He later pursued doctoral studies at the University at Buffalo, gaining international recognition through awards in electroacoustic music. Mentored by leading composers, he developed a distinctive style influenced by mythology, psychology, and the arts. Since 2006, he has served as Professor at the University of Oklahoma, with his works performed globally and featured in numerous international recordings.
